Spend your days soaking up some sunshine at this charming waterfront home on Lake Chelan. Enjoy the unobstructed views from within the home, patio, or wraparound deck. Featuring a private dock, there's a little something for everyone here. Cool down at the end of the day with the newly installed air-conditioning. This home lies on the south shore of Lake Chelan, just a short drive from the Lake Chelan State Park, where there are hiking trails and a boat launch. Take a drive down the lake, and you'll find great wineries within eight miles and restaurants, shopping, and family fun at Slidewaters in downtown Chelan. Pros: the house was clean enough, the bedding was not too scratchy or motel like, there were plenty of rooms and a lot of space, this is a house that is on the lake. Cons: My sister paid almost $900 to spend two nights here this house should not legally be rented out to people with small children. The deck has a wire railing around it but several of the wires are broken, either hanging loosely or hanging off entirely. Most of the broken wires are located on the area of the deck that is above a concrete set of stairs leading down to the water. A crawling child like the one we brought could have crawled right through the broken wires and fallen down onto concrete steps or into the water, or a larger child could get their head through the loosened wires and have problems that way. Bedroom on the lowest floor has a door that leads directly outside, to the unfenced unsecured back end of the property. There is water access, anyone could walk up or look in from the neighboring docks or yacht club because the door has a large window with no curtains or blinds to cover it. There is also no deadbolt on this door, and no gate or fence to keep anyone from entering. The master bedroom has blackout curtains, all the other rooms have blinds with no coverings meaning they were all light by 5:30 a.m. The hot water in the kitchen tonight, I reached out to guest services no one ever replied to me.
